Refined Consign & Design open in Centennial Discover awesome!
Beginning with the clever name, adorable logo (mascot Dolly in FLEURISH her throne chair), metal sculpted Maxine with her floral cart to greet customers at the entrance, there’s a fresh new presence in Centennial. Refined consign in the business name is just that. The vast showroom of consigned furniture is so carefully curated and cared for that it’s refined and one can hardly tell it’s not new. In many cases there is an interesting history of the piece and an equally fascinating story of where it’s going with the new owner. In addition, there is art and new merchandise to accessorize the home or office and the expertise of established interior designer Brenda Thompson who has had a loyal following for decades (Thompson Design & Associates). Brenda’s husband Tom Thompson has decades of experience in several facets of the furniture business in multiple cities. What a powerful ownership combo! They quickly added visual merchandiser Kathy Doddridge to the team. Many may remember Kathy from the popular boutique Twigs that was located just across the parking lot. Handsome brick arches are distinctive features in this center that once housed Compleat Gourmet. Refined Consign & Design is located at the Southeast corner of South University Boulevard and East Dry Creek. The address is 7562 S. University Blvd.
